2009 Audi A8 vs. 2004 Honda S2000
To start off, 2009 Audi A8 is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2004 Honda S2000.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2004 Honda S2000 would be higher. At 5,998 cc, 2009 Audi A8 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Audi A8 (444 HP @ 6200 RPM) has 192 more horse power than 2004 Honda S2000. (252 HP @ 5500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Audi A8 should accelerate faster than 2004 Honda S2000.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2009 Audi A8 weights approximately 709 kg more than 2004 Honda S2000.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2009 Audi A8 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2004 Honda S2000.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2009 Audi A8 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 Audi A8 (580 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 363 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 Honda S2000. (217 Nm @ 7500 RPM). This means 2009 Audi A8 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 Honda S2000. 2009 Audi A8 has automatic transmission and 2004 Honda S2000 has manual transmission. 2004 Honda S2000 will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2009 Audi A8 will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2009 Audi A8 | 2004 Honda S2000 | |
Make | Audi | Honda |
Model | A8 | S2000 |
Year Released | 2009 | 2004 |
Body Type | Sedan | Convertible |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5998 cc | 2147 cc |
Engine Type | W |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 444 HP | 252 HP |
Engine RPM | 6200 RPM | 5500 RPM |
Torque | 580 Nm | 217 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4000 RPM | 7500 RPM |
Engine Compression Ratio | 11.0:1 | 11.0: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line |
Drive Type | 4WD | Rear |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 2 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1995 kg | 1286 kg |
Vehicle Length | 5190 mm | 4120 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1900 mm | 1760 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1460 mm | 1290 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 3080 mm | 2410 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 13.8 L/100km | 10.7 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 90 L | 50 L |
